Plano Collor (1990)
The real-life Brazilian economic policy that froze citizens' bank accounts, causing mass poverty and triggering a wave of emigration.
Reverse Colonization
Brazilians migrating to Portugal out of desperation, only to face discrimination and marginalization.
Exile / Statelessness
Paco and Alex represent the "lost generation" of Brazil—they feel they have no home in Brazil, nor in Europe.
Cinematography
Shot in black-and-white to visually represent the hopelessness, melancholy, and death of the characters' dreams.
Paco
The protagonist. A young, broke, aspiring actor from São Paulo who becomes a smuggler to honor his dead mother.
Alex
A young Brazilian immigrant in Lisbon. She works as a waitress, feels trapped in Europe, and dreams of a better life.
Manuela
Paco's mother. A Spanish immigrant in Brazil who dies of a heart attack when her life savings are frozen by the government.
Marcos
Alex’s boyfriend in Lisbon. A struggling Brazilian musician who gets dangerously involved in the diamond smuggling ring.
Igor
The antique dealer and criminal in São Paulo who hires Paco to be a drug/diamond mule.
Kraft
The ruthless criminal boss in Lisbon who runs the smuggling operation.
